In the current industrial era, the demand for high-efficiency solid-liquid separation has transitioned from a standard utility to a critical driver of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) compliance. Global industries, ranging from mining to pharmaceuticals, are facing stricter regulations regarding wastewater discharge and resource recovery. As a result, the "one-size-fits-all" approach to filtration is obsolete.
Modern Filtration System Design now integrates AI-driven monitoring, automated sludge handling, and membrane technologies that reduce energy consumption by up to 30%. For global enterprises, selecting a partner capable of O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) and ODM (Original Design Manufacturer) services is no longer just about cost—it is about securing a localized, engineered solution that adapts to specific chemical compositions and flow rates.
Increasing scarcity of freshwater is driving a 15% CAGR in the adoption of Zero Liquid Discharge (ZLD) systems across North America and the EU.
The shift toward "Industry 4.0" requires filtration systems to feature PLC-controlled automatic cloth washing and real-time pressure diagnostics.
Recovery of precious metals from industrial tailings and nutrients from food waste has turned filter presses into profit centers.
